The Tensioner Bearing, often overlooked, plays a critical role in maintaining engine timing and performance. Replacing it with a subpar product could lead to belt misalignment, engine noise, or even severe engine damage.

Automotive repair specialists are recommending that drivers pay closer attention to signs of a failing Tensioner Bearing, such as unusual belt noise, vibrations, or engine misfires.
